January–February: Turkmenistan Exports 209 Tons of Chocolate to Uzbekistan

Turkmenistan exported 209.1 tons of chocolate products to Uzbekistan in January–February 2026, Uzbekistan’s National Statistics Committee reported Thursday.

During the period, Uzbekistan imported about 6,600 tons of chocolate from 34 countries, totaling $27.7 million.

Russia remained the largest supplier with 4,407 tons. Other key exporters included Ukraine with 607 tons, Kazakhstan with 201.8 tons and Türkiye with 190.7 tons. Poland supplied 124.4 tons.

Trade turnover between Turkmenistan and Uzbekistan reached $149.5 million in January–February 2026.
